public class SSORPreconditioner extends Object implements Preconditioner
A = D + L + LtThe SSOR preconditioning matrix is defined as
M = (D + L)D-1(D + L)tor, parameterized by ω
M(ω) = (1/(2 - ω))(D / ω + L)(D / ω)-1(D / ω + L)t
The optimal ω reduces the number of iterations to a lower order. In practice, however, the spectral information for computing the optimal ω is expensive to obtain.
|Constructor and Description|
Construct an SSOR preconditioner with a symmetric coefficient matrix.
|Modifier and Type||Method and Description|
Solve Mz = x using this SSOR preconditioner.
Mtx = M-1x as M is symmetric.
public SSORPreconditioner(Matrix A, double omega)
A- a symmetric coefficient matrix
omega- an extrapolation factor
Copyright © 2010-2018 Numerical Method Incorporation Limited. All Rights Reserved.